Nvidia is getting ready to launch its next-gen Blackwell desktop GPUs. Hardware leaker Kopite7kimi has published specifications for the RTX 5090 and RTX 5080. This leak has sparked excitement and anticipation among gaming enthusiasts and tech aficionados alike, as Nvidia's GPU releases are always highly anticipated events in the tech world.
RTX 5090 Specifications Unveiled
According to the leak by Kopite7kimi, Nvidia's upcoming RTX 5090 is set to make waves in the GPU market with its impressive specs. One of the standout features of the RTX 5090 is its reported 32GB of VRAM, a significant upgrade from the previous generation GPUs. This increase in VRAM capacity is expected to provide a substantial boost in performance for graphics-intensive tasks such as gaming, content creation, and AI processing.
The RTX 5090 is also rumored to come with hefty power requirements, which may necessitate users to ensure their systems have adequate power supplies to handle the GPU's demands.
